Robert Chappel Obituary


Family-Placed Obituary


CHAPPEL, Mr. Robert U. "Buster" age 68, of Dayton, departed this life Friday, June 15, 2007 at Grandview Hospital. He was born to Robert W. and Naomi Chappel, and a graduate of Roosevelt High School, Class of 1956. Retired from the United States Air Force after 22 years of dedicated service at the rank of Senior Master Sargeant. Also, a retiree of the United States Postal Service after 30 dedicated years of service at the level of Post Master. Preceded in death by his father, Robert W. Chappel; wife, Leora "BeBe" Chappel; daughter, Robin Parker Chappel. Survivors include his son, Jody K. (Audrey) Chappel; mother, Naomi Chappel; sister, Donna Jean Dyer, of New Lebanon, OH; brother, Geoffrey (Kathy) Chappel; sister-in-law, Yvonne Montague; life long friend, Lawrence Calhoun, of Los Angeles, CA; 9 grandchildren, Jody Jr., Jare', Jawaun, Jovani, Tory, Roderick, Dorian, Spencer & Kayla Chappel; 2 great grandchildren, Jody III & Jaion' Chappel; a host of other relatives and friends. Funeral service will be held 11 am Friday, June 22, 2007 at the HOUSE OF WHEAT Funeral Home, Inc., 2107 North Gettysburg Avenue. Rev. Andre Hayes officiating. Interment Dayton National Cemetery. Visitation 9 am Friday at the funeral home until the time of service. Family will receive friends one hour prior to service. Online condolences may be expressed at [email protected]
